雨中的策略性排污

Strategic emissions in the rain
Journal of Development Economics · 2026 · Runhao Zhao、Ye Yuan

中文摘要

企业策略性地选择排放地点与时机以规避环境规制。我们揭示了一种新型的时间性规避行为:企业在强降雨期间向水体排放废水。通过采用双重差分(DID)方法,并分析高频水质监测数据与降雨数据,我们发现,与污染企业密度较低的集水区相比,污染企业密集的集水区水污染物浓度上升更为显著。我们的实证发现与一个简化模型的预测一致:该模型表明,在基于阈值的监测制度下,污染者会利用降雨的稀释效应策略性地增加废水排放。我们估计,这种隐蔽的“雨中排污”行为可抵消中国年度减排目标的43%。

Abstract

Firms strategically locate and time their emissions to evade environmental regulations. We uncover a novel form of temporal evasion: firms discharge wastewater into waterways during periods of heavy rains. By employing a difference-in-differences approach and analyzing high-frequency water quality monitoring and rainfall data, we find that water pollution concentrations rise more significantly in catchment areas densely populated by polluting firms relative to low-density areas. Our empirical findings align with a stylized model that predicts polluters exploit the dilution effects of rainfall to strategically increase wastewater discharge under a threshold-based monitoring system. We estimate that this covert “polluting-in-the-rain” behavior can offset 43% of China’s annual emission reduction targets.
